A visible-light-mediated metal-free oxidation of 1-benzyl-3,4-dihydroisoquinolines
(1-BnDHIQs) for the switchable preparation of a wide range of 1-benzoylisoquinolines
(BzIQs) and 1-benzoyl-3,4-dihydroisoquinolines (BzDHIQs) is realized using dioxygen
as the oxidant. This protocol provides a facile route for the efficient synthesis
of isoquinoline alkaloids. Mechanistic investigations suggest that a radical pathway
and an ionic pathway may exist simultaneously, with both pathways proceeding via a
common key peroxide intermediate to give the oxidized products.
